How to prevent shaving rash?

To prevent shaving rash, it's important you prepare your hair and tend to your delicate skin with the best luxury bath and shower products. Trimming the hair before you attack it with a razor will make it all easier to manage. If you’re tugging at the area, trying to navigate long hair, you’re more likely to irritate the skin and cause a rash.

Exfoliating is a great way to slough away dead cells so you can shave as close to the skin as possible. Pick up a gentle exfoliator to keep the skin soft and supple. And use a hydrating shaving gel oil to help protect the skin as you shave. How can you shave without getting razor bumps?

To avoid the dreaded shaving bumps, it’s important you use a shaving balm or gel-oil that calms the skin and helps it stay smooth. First-time shaving razor bumps are usually a result of shaving the hair in the wrong direction. Unlike shaving your legs, which feels intuitive, shaving your bikini area takes a little more attention.

After exfoliating, apply your Lady Suite Rejuvenating Botanical Oil for the Glow Below 30ml, which hydrates the skin and helps prevent shaving ingrown hair and rashes. With one hand, pull your skin taut. Then look to see what direction your hair is growing in. Shave the hair in the direction of its growth to prevent irritation or pimples after shaving.

How do I prevent ingrown hairs after shaving?

To prevent ingrown hairs after shaving, it’s important you tend to your skin gently. Always use a hydrating gel-oil and a good shaving cream for bikini area. Be sure to rinse the area thoroughly after shaving. Finish your routine with an aftershave balm to keep the area soft and bump-free. Avoid swimming or very hot water immediately after. And keep gently exfoliating the area every time you bathe or shower.

If you’re still wondering how to stop shaving rash, it’s important you consider the products you use. A dull razor and dry skin are a recipe for disaster. Your skin will feel irritated. And as you drag the razor across your skin, you may invite ingrown hairs and pimples under the skin. Always take care of your skin with a soft touch, and invest in luxury products that tend to your troubled areas. Keep your aftercare products in the fridge. That way, if you do get a razor burn on the bikini area, you’ll have something that will soothe your shaving rash instantly.
